Yi-Jun Sheu is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Cell Biology and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ience. According to data from OpenAlex, Yi-Jun Sheu has authored 12 papers receiving a total of 1.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 12 papers in Molecular Biology, 4 papers in Cell Biology and 1 paper in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ience. Recurrent topics in Yi-Jun Sheu's work include DNA Repair Mechanisms (7 papers), Fungal and yeast genetics research (6 papers) and CRISPR and Genetic Engineering (3 papers). Yi-Jun Sheu is often cited by papers focused on DNA Repair Mechanisms (7 papers), Fungal and yeast genetics research (6 papers) and CRISPR and Genetic Engineering (3 papers). Yi-Jun Sheu collaborates with scholars based in United States, France and Canada. Yi-Jun Sheu's co-authors include Bruce Stillman, M Snyder, Kevin Madden, Brenda Andrews, Kristin Baetz, Christine Costigan, Nathalie Fortin, Beatriz Santos, Yves Barral and Peter Burgers and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Science and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ences.
